#Fact
1Daughter of Aaron Spelling and Candy Spelling.
2Older sister of Randy Spelling.
3Niece of Dan Spelling.
4Published author.
5One of four actors to appear in both the Scream (1996) franchise and its parody, the Scary Movie (2000) franchise. The other three actors are: Anthony Anderson, Jenny McCarthy, and Jerry O'Connell.
6Her parents were both from Jewish families (from Poland and Russia on her father's side, and from Hungary, Germany, and Poland on her mother's side).
7She has played the same character (Donna Martin) on three different series: Beverly Hills, 90210 (1990), Melrose Place (1992) and 90210 (2008).
8Was on bed rest throughout most of her fourth pregnancy and later had emergency surgery due to complications from her last C-section.
9Tori has four children with her husband, Dean McDermott: Liam McDermott (aka Liam Aaron McDermott), born March 13, 2007, weighing 6 lbs. 6 oz.; Stella McDermott (aka Stella Doreen McDermott), born June 9, 2008, weighing 6 lbs. 8 oz.; Hattie McDermott (aka Hattie Margaret McDermott), born October 10, 2011, weighing 6 lbs. 14 oz. and Finn McDermott (aka Finn Davey McDermott), born August 30, 2012, weighing 6 lbs. 6 oz., at Cedars-Sinai Medical Center, Los Angeles, California, all by C-section (Liam was an emergency C-section).
10Accidentally crashed her car into a school building, trying to avoid the paparazzi, while taking her kids to school on June 13, 2011. She and her kids came away with no serious injuries.
11Lives in Encino, California.
12Her dog, Mimi La Rue, died on June 17, 2008 of natural causes at age 11.
13Tori chose Liam's middle name of Aaron, to honor her late father and Hattie's middle name Margaret, after her childhood nanny. Her husband Dean chose Stella's middle name of Doreen, to honor his late mother. Their youngest child, Finn, takes his middle name from Tori and her paternal grandfather.
14Goddaughter of Barbara Stanwyck and Dean Martin.
15Said she took a course on-line to become an ordained minister [July 10, 2007].
16Mentioned in the rap-rock song Mope by Bloodhound Gang, along with personalities like Luciano Pavarotti, Tupac Shakur, The Notorious B.I.G., Falco, Bo Jackson and Wolfgang Amadeus Mozart.
17Reconciled with her mother, Candy Spelling, just days before her first child, Liam McDermott, was born. The two had troubles with each other after criticizing each other in public.
18Eloped with Dean McDermott to a private island in Fiji on May 7, 2006.
19Farrah Fawcett was a neighbor for ten years when they lived in the same apartment building.
20Was among the guests at the weddings of former Beverly Hills, 90210 (1990) co-stars Jason Priestley to Naomi Lowde-Priestley and Tiffani Thiessen to Brady Smith. [2005]
21Tori wore a $50,000 Badgley Mischka crystal-beaded gown in her July 2004 wedding to Charlie Shahnaian.
22Ranked #23 in VH1 100 Greatest Teen Stars (2006).
23Her name Tori means 'Bird' in Japanese.
24(December 27, 2005) Engaged to her Mind Over Murder (2005) co-star, Dean McDermott.
25Graduated from Harvard-Westlake School, a high school in Los Angeles.
26Introduced 7th Heaven (1996) star Barry Watson to his first wife Laura Payne-Gabriel.
27Was one of the very first celebrity Yoga Booty Ballet students in Santa Monica, California
28(November 25, 2003) Announced engagement to writer/actor Charlie Shahnaian whom she met during the Los Angeles production of his play "Maybe, Baby It's You".
29Had small plastic surgery on her nose after a parrot bit her [November 1994].
30Has a small tattoo of a rose on her left ankle.
